Official Description (provided by the hotel):
Quickenberry is a lovely small lodge in a stunning setting high above the Rakaia Gorge with views over rolling country side and towards Mt. Hutt. It is peaceful and quiet giving a feeling of remoteness yet it is only one hour from Christchurch Airport. There are many walks nearby, there is golf and skiing and many other activities. All rooms have all modern facilities; there is a large lounge with open fire, library and cozy dining room. ... more   less
